Common Roofing System Problems Identified
What are the most typical roofing system problems that property proprietors should be aware of? An additional typical problem is roof covering leaks, typically stemming from defective blinking around smokeshafts, skylights, or vents.
Furthermore, granule loss from asphalt shingles is a constant issue, indicating deterioration that can shorten the roofing's lifespan - Roof Inspection Company. Blocked seamless gutters can also bring about water pooling and succeeding damages, highlighting the relevance of regular upkeep. Moss and algae growth can catch moisture, potentially leading to rot and degeneration of roofing materials.
Finally, architectural issues, such as sagging or irregular surface areas, may symbolize underlying troubles with the roof's support system. Acknowledging these usual roof issues is necessary for building proprietors to make certain the durability and stability of their roofing systems, enabling prompt treatment prior to more severe repercussions develop.

Inspection Process Described
Thoroughness is vital during the roofing assessment process, as it guarantees that all potential issues are recognized and analyzed properly. The assessment normally begins with a visual examination of the roof covering's outside, where examiners look for signs of degeneration, wear, or damages.
Adhering to the exterior inspection, the indoor areas, especially the attic, are reviewed for indications of wetness, water, or mold stains. This evaluation helps recognize any leakages that may not be noticeable from the outside. Assessors likewise examine insulation and ventilation systems to guarantee they are functioning appropriately, as poor air flow can cause substantial problems with time.
Furthermore, the examination may include making use of specialized tools, such as moisture meters or infrared cams, to detect covert issues. As soon as the inspection is complete, a comprehensive record is created, outlining any findings and suggested repair services. This thorough approach not only identifies existing problems however additionally help in projecting future upkeep demands, ultimately saving homeowners from costly repair work.
